4: Competitor Withdrawal / Credit Policy

If for any reason the applicant who has already successfully entered the event find themselves unable to race and wishes to withdraw from the event, the applicant must inform 'The Promoter' in writing. This should be done initially via e-mail to duathlon@lincolntri.co.uk . Please note athletes can NOT withdraw via social media.

Applicants should receive a confirmation of their withdrawal within 7 working days.

Applicants who inform the promoter in writing of their wish to withdraw before the withdrawal date of the event as outlined in the Appendix, will receive a race credit to the value of 50% of the original entry fee to be used against the following years event.

The promoter will hold your race credit details for up to 12 months.

Please note that credits are not transferable between applicants.

6: Attempted Swapping of Entries

Please note that the swapping of entries between applicants is strictly forbidden as it invalidates insurances undertaken by the Promoter to cover the event. The consequences of attempting such an undertaking by any applicant is so serious in jeopardising the continuation of events that any applicant found to have passed their entry to another applicant and any applicant found to have taken up that entry will both be banned for life from all future events organised by the Promoter.

7: Transfer of Entry and Deferral

Under no circumstances are applicants permitted to transfer their entry to either another event, to another individual or defer their entry to the following season. Applicants are instead, requested to follow the guidelines as outlined in the Competitor Withdrawal and Credit Policy section as outlined above, using the Race Credit supplied where applicable to re-apply for another race/event.

11: Late Entries

As the event takes place on an active RAF base we are unable to offer late entries or on the day entries due to the security arrangements in place for the event.

12: Event Changes

The above named Promoter has the right to change any event for the reason of safety without prior notice.

13: Event Cancellation

If for reasons beyond the control of the Promoter, including an 'act of God' due to unforeseen, naturally occurring events that were unavoidable, the event which applicants have entered is cancelled or postponed, the Promoters will issue a full Race Credit to the value of the original entry fee or transfer the applicant’s entry to another race/event where requested. Alternatively, if an event is cancelled by the Promoter for non ‘act of god’ reasons, the Promoters will offer a full refund.
